Given:
The adjacent angles of the parallelogram are,
![28,\text{ and }3x](https://img.qammunity.org/2023/formulas/mathematics/college/tafh0unpq8hbiqt4sjck86ojxesmmwrrve.png)
To find:
The value of x.
Step-by-step explanation:
We know that,
The sum of the two adjacent angles between the parallel lines is supplementary.
So, we write,
![\begin{gathered} 28+3x=180 \\ 3x=180-28 \\ 3x=152 \\ x=50.66 \\ x\approx50.7 \end{gathered}](https://img.qammunity.org/2023/formulas/mathematics/college/zqeq4mnx11krui8fklybv3m3ektbzq9xme.png)
Thus, the value of x is 50.7.
